Concentrate

verb/KON-sen-trate/

To focus all your attention and thought on one thing.

Concentrate on the ball and keep your eye on it until you hit it.

'Concentrate' shares 'centre' — you pull your thoughts into one centre and focus.

'Concentrate on' something means giving it full focus; it can also mean making a liquid stronger.
